What is SmartFTP
SmartFTP is a Windows-based FTP client used to transfer files between local systems and remote servers over protocols such as FTP, FTPS, SFTP, and WebDAV. It is typically used by IT staff, web administrators, and support teams to manage uploads/downloads, synchronize folders, and automate recurring transfers. The product focuses on a desktop client experience with multi-connection management, transfer queueing, and scripting/automation options rather than a server-side managed file transfer platform.
Broad protocol support
SmartFTP supports common file transfer protocols including FTP, FTPS, SFTP, and WebDAV, which helps teams standardize on one client across different endpoints. This reduces the need to maintain multiple tools for different server types. It also supports common authentication patterns used with these protocols (for example, SSH keys for SFTP).
Queueing and transfer automation
The client includes a transfer queue and scheduling features that help manage large batches of files and recurring jobs. It supports resumable transfers and can continue queued operations after interruptions, depending on server capabilities. For desktop-centric workflows, these features provide practical automation without deploying additional server infrastructure.
Windows integration and usability
SmartFTP provides a Windows GUI with multi-tab/multi-connection management and common file operations, which can be easier for non-developer operators than command-line tools. It integrates with typical Windows environments and can be used interactively for ad hoc support tasks. This makes it suitable for teams that need a user-operated client rather than an API-first service.
Client-only, not MFT platform
SmartFTP is primarily an end-user client and does not provide the centralized governance, auditing, and policy controls associated with managed file transfer servers and gateways. Organizations needing enterprise-wide workflow orchestration, centralized key management, and compliance reporting often require additional infrastructure. This can limit its fit for regulated, high-volume B2B transfer programs.
Windows-centric deployment
SmartFTP is designed for Windows, which can be a constraint for organizations standardizing on macOS/Linux endpoints or containerized automation. Cross-platform teams may need alternative clients or separate automation approaches for non-Windows environments. This increases operational complexity when consistent tooling across OSs is required.
Limited data integration capabilities
While it can automate file movement, SmartFTP is not a full data integration tool for transforming, mapping, validating, or routing data across applications. Integrations are generally file-transfer oriented rather than connector-based to SaaS/ERP systems. Teams may need separate ETL/iPaaS tooling for end-to-end integration workflows beyond transport.
Plan & Pricing
| Plan | Price | Key features & notes |
|---|---|---|
| Professional (perpetual) | $399.95 one-time per user | Perpetual license: right to use current version; includes upgrades for 1 year. |
| Professional (subscription) | $79.99 per user/year | Subscription billed yearly; includes upgrades during subscription term. |
| Ultimate (perpetual) | $599.95 one-time per user | All Pro features plus additional integrations (OneDrive, Google Drive, password managers, terminal client). |
| Ultimate (subscription) | $119.99 per user/year | Subscription billed yearly; includes upgrades during subscription term. |
| Enterprise (perpetual) | $1,649.95 one-time per user | All Ultimate features plus Scheduler, Amazon S3, Google Cloud Storage, enterprise features. |
| Enterprise (subscription) | $329.99 per user/year | Subscription billed yearly; includes upgrades during subscription term. |
| Enterprise Logger (perpetual add-on) | $4,999.00 one-time per user | Enterprise add-on for logging/auditing. |
| Enterprise Logger (subscription) | $999.00 per user/year | Yearly subscription for Enterprise Logger add-on. |
| Enterprise OpenPGP (perpetual add-on) | $5,999.00 one-time per user | Enterprise add-on for OpenPGP encryption. |
| Enterprise OpenPGP (subscription) | $1,199.00 per user/year | Yearly subscription for OpenPGP add-on. |
| SmartFTP FTP Library (SDK) | $1,599.00 per computer/year (subscription) | FTP Library licensed per computer; subscription billed yearly. |
Notes: All prices listed in USD. Prices effective from February 12, 2026, per the vendor's Price List. SmartFTP offers a 30-day free evaluation (trial) that runs in Enterprise mode with no limitations; after evaluation a paid license is required (perpetual or subscription).
